Abstract:
      Field experiment was conducted to investigate the accumulation characteristics and dynamic distribution of Cd in ten genotypes of rice. The results showed that the distribution of Cd in various rice plant parts was in the order:root>leaf and stem >husk>brown rice. The concentrations of Cd in roots of conventional rice were the lowest at seeding stage, and the highest at tillering stage, while of Cd in root of hybrid rice with growth cycle less than 120 days and over 120 days were the highest at tillering stage and mature stage, respectively. The tendency of Cd concentration in leaf and shoot of rice increased firstly, decreased, and then increased to a peak at mature stage. In the present study, the contents of Cd in brown rice samples(Xiang Zao-xian 42 and T-you 705) were relatively low among conventional rice and hybrid rice, while the ranges of concentrations of Cd in brown rice(0.21~1.53 mg·kg-1) were closed to, even beyond the limit of the food health standard(0.2 mg·kg-1).
